The origins of Spanish humor can be traced back to the country's rich literary and theatrical traditions. The works of renowned writers such as Miguel de Cervantes and Lope de Vega, with their blend of satire, irony, and absurdity, have shaped the development of Spanish comedy. Moreover, the vibrant street culture of Spain, with its bustling markets and lively plazas, has provided a fertile ground for laughter and spontaneous humor.

One of the defining characteristics of Spanish comedy videos is their focus on physical comedy. Slapstick, pratfalls, and over-the-top gestures are common elements, eliciting laughter through exaggerated and often absurd situations. Comedians such as Joaquín Reyes and Ignatius Farray are masters of this physical brand of humor, keeping audiences in stitches with their outrageous antics and impeccable timing.

Beyond physical comedy, Spanish comedy videos often rely on clever wordplay, witty observations, and social commentary. Stand-up comedians like Dani Rovira and Eva Hache are renowned for their sharp wit and ability to find humor in everyday life. Their routines often touch upon topical issues, poking fun at politics, current events, and societal norms with a touch of satire and irony.

Sketch comedy is another popular genre in Spanish comedy videos. Groups such as "El Hormiguero" and "La Hora Chanante" have created memorable and hilarious sketches that combine absurd scenarios, quirky characters, and a healthy dose of improvisation. Their ability to blend humor with surrealism and unexpected plot twists has earned them a devoted following.
